Output 45941255c56a89c59e801567c0baa081eefa64aec59e5aadbb832f3d310e7e67:12

value
1445328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41bce706d9a22e2d8c6a99c6a74d0b92ef22ad3e OP_EQUAL
address
37gc9BgP5CzVUXsCVoCWpAYwaJRqqdCeh7
transaction
45941255c56a89c59e801567c0baa081eefa64aec59e5aadbb832f3d310e7e67
confirmations
209582
spent
true